Description du poste
Position

Title: Chemical Mix Technician

Shift

Rotating 3rd Shift (D); 2-2-3 Schedule; 5:30PM - 5:30AM

Training Requirement

4-6 months on Rotating Day Shift: 2-2-3 Schedule; 5:30AM-5:30PM

Compensation & Benefits

$24.00 - $28.50 per hour (with shift premium)

Opportunity to increase your wage with our pay for skill program.

Medical, dental, vision and prescription drug coverage.

401k w/company match.

FLSA: Non-Exempt.

Essential Accountabilities
  • Chemical Mix Technicians work in a fast-paced environment making priority-based manufacturing decisions in a leadership role. Individuals must possess a high attention to detail, superior time management skills, and the ability to communicate with all levels of the organization from floor personnel to upper management.
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ment
  • Ability to stand for long periods, bend, reach, grab and twist
  • Making Automated and Manual batches using Rockwell
  • Testing batches for release criteria
  • Special Projects (ex: Trials, Editing Work Instructions, FM-s, Kan Ban)
  • Cycle Counts/Inventory Tracking
  • Ability to accurately complete documentation
  • Forklift Driving
Required Skills
  • Basic computer skills are required.
  • Previous manufacturing experience.
  • Must have the ability to read, write, and communicate in English.
  • Physical examination and pre-employment drug screen will be required upon conditional job offer.
  • Past analytical lab experience (pH meters, manual and automated titrators, reagent preparation, etc.)
  • Past cGMP experience and/or basic knowledge or cGMP protocols.
  • Prioritize tasks and work on several formulations simultaneously.
